Note that the aorta becomes increasingly tortuous as people age. Sometimes, the sidewall of a tortuous aorta can appear similar to an intraluminal clot. This is further reason to image the aorta in two orthogonal axes, as pathology is usually visible in both axes. TOE may make oblique measurements when the descending aorta is elongated or tortuous. To avoid this overestimation, aortic diameter measurement by TOE should be attempted only when circular sections are obtained. It’s called your descending thoracic aorta until it reaches your diaphragm.Jul 9, 2019 · Maybe a warning: A tortuous aorta is one that is not straight ( the normal condition ) but does not contain and aneurysm. This may occur normally in older people or those with long standing hypertension. It may also occur in younger people who have abnormal composition of their artery walls.
